Virtual Trash Clean Up
November, 2025
Throughout November, 35 volunteers helped clean up trash across Pflugerville’s parks and trails, collecting an incredible 107 bags of litter. We wrapped up the month with a group clean-up at Lake Pflugerville and a raffle featuring prizes donated by local businesses. Thank you to everyone who helped keep our parks clean and beautiful!

Lake Pflugerville Tree Planting
November, 2025
PfPF partnered with the City Pforester to plant 21 new trees at Lake Pflugerville. With help from 14 dedicated volunteers, we added shade and beauty to one of our community’s favorite outdoor spaces. Thank you to everyone who came out to dig in and make a lasting impact!

Pflugerville Heritage Park Pfood Pforest (H3P) Work Day
September, 2025
The Pflugerville Parks Foundation partnered with the City Pforester and the Citizen Pforester group for a hands-on morning of mulching in the Pflugerville Heritage Park Pfood Pforest (H3P). Together we spread 10 yards of mulch helping to keep the Pfood Pforest healthy and thriving!

Lake Pflugerville Trash Clean-Up
August, 2025
PfPF partnered with the city and local volunteers to help clean up Lake Pflugerville. Our team helped remove more than 84 bags of trash from the lake and along the bank.

Planting native tree seedlings and scattering native grass and wildflower seeds
April, 2025
PfPF partnered with the city’s Urban Pforester and the Citizen Pforester group to plant 600 native tree saplings and scatter 30+ pounds of native grass and wildflower seeds. We also picked up 10 bags of trash!

Invasive Species Removal
February, 2025
PfPF partnered with the city’s Urban Pforester and the Citizen Pforester group for an invasive species removal along Gilleland Creek. We also planted several dozen trees!
